7.1 Errors and Alarms

If an alarm is triggered, the drive's LCD screen will display the fault code text and the Variable Speed Pump will stop running.
Disconnect power to the pump and wait until the keypad LEDs have all turned off. At this point, reconnect power to the
pump. If the error has not cleared then proper troubleshooting will be required. Use the error description table below to begin
troubleshooting.
Fault Code
E-01
Inverter unit protection
E-02
Acceleration over current
E-03
Deceleration over current
E-04
Constant speed over current
E-05
Acceleration over voltage
E-06
Deceleration over voltage
E-07
Constant speed over voltage
E-08
Under voltage fault
E-09
Motor overload
E-16—Communication Link between the HMI and Motor Control has been Lost: Check the jacketed wire on the back
side of the keypad inside the drive top cover. Ensure that the 5 pin connector is properly plugged into the socket and that there is
no damage to the cable.
E-01,02,03,04,05,06,07,09,10,24—Internal Errors: If this error displays multiple times, then there may be a problem with
the pump's rotating assembly. Please disassemble the pump and investigate to see if there is a problem with the impeller or
mechanical seal. See page 15 "Pump Disassembly" for instructions for disassembling the pump.
E-08—Absolute AC Under Voltage Detected: This indicates that the supply voltage has dropped below the
operating range of 200v. This could be caused by normal voltage variation and will clear itself. Otherwise there
could be excess voltage sag caused by improper installation or improper supply voltage.
E-14—Module Overheating: Should be caused by high ambient temperature or overload.

Fault Code
E-10
Inverter overload
E-11
Phase loss at input side
E-12
Phase failure at output side
E-14
Module overheating
E-16
Communication fault
E-17
Current detection fault
E-24
Inverter hardware fault
